Aston Villa midfielder Marvelous Nakamba will on Friday launch his Under-17 football tournament in Bulawayo, which has generated a lot of interest since its announcement this week.

The English Premiership ace, who is currently in Zimbabwe for an off-season hiatus, said more than 400 youth players were set to benefit from the competition.

“We are excited to announce that we have finally received clearance to host the inaugural Marvelous Nakamba Under-17 football tournament,” he said through his newly-formed Marvelous Nakamba Foundation.

“It gives us great pleasure to know that we have the support of football custodians as we endeavour to empower grassroots football through this tournament that will see over 400 budding football get an opportunity to showcase the talent that we have in abundance.”

“We would also love to be quick to mention that due to Covid-19 protocols, this will be a closed event. We will make sure that all football lovers will be able to follow the action in the comfort of their homes as this tournament will be streamed live through social media,” Nakamba added.

The Aston Villa star said he took the initiative so as to support soccer development in Zimbabwe.

He added: “Grassroots football is a very important part of the survival of football, we have all come through the system of being afforded chances at the early stage and it is befitting that we continue the tradition of grassroots sports.

“We appreciate the approval from the custodians of football and it is hoped that the tournament will raise the curtain to the commencement of junior football in the country.”

The former Bantu Rovers player has been impressive at the English Premiership side, making 50 appearances including in their 2021 final match in which they won 2-1 against European Champions League winners Chelsea.
